Bob Hogan and Pete Silcox found this kit in the Bob McCarthy estate (owner of The Supply Car). Bob is unsure of how many of these 50-foot cars Bob McCarthy produced, and he is also not sure what the prototype for this model is.

Road Name:

Northern Pacific (NP)

Notes:

Prototype road numbers were 20550 through 20563. The combined door width was 9'9".
